国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

sass和scss 有何區(qū)別?

這篇具有很好參考價值的文章主要介紹了sass和scss 有何區(qū)別?。希望對大家有所幫助。如果存在錯誤或未考慮完全的地方,請大家不吝賜教,您也可以點擊"舉報違法"按鈕提交疑問。

Sass(Syntactically Awesome Style Sheets)和 SCSS(Sassy CSS)都是用于編寫樣式表的CSS預處理器,它們有很多相似之處,但也有一些重要的區(qū)別:

1、語法差異:

Sass 使用縮進來表示代碼塊,類似于Python。它使用縮進和換行符來區(qū)分不同的代碼塊。
SCSS 使用更類似于傳統(tǒng)CSS的語法,使用花括號 {} 和分號 ; 來分隔代碼塊。

2、文件擴展名:

Sass 文件使用 .sass 擴展名。
SCSS 文件使用 .scss 擴展名。

3、兼容性:

SCSS 更加兼容傳統(tǒng)的 CSS 語法,這意味著你可以逐漸遷移現(xiàn)有的 CSS 代碼到 SCSS,而不需要進行大規(guī)模的重寫。
Sass 的語法相對更加簡潔,但不太兼容傳統(tǒng) CSS,因此在遷移時需要更多的工作。

4、使用方式:

由于 SCSS 的語法更接近于 CSS,因此它更容易學習和使用,尤其是對于那些已經熟悉 CSS 的開發(fā)者。
Sass 的語法可能對一些人來說更具吸引力,因為它更簡潔,但可能需要一些時間來適應。

5、流行度:

目前,SCSS 更受歡迎,更廣泛地使用,因為它更容易學習和集成到現(xiàn)有項目中。

總的來說,Sass 和 SCSS 都是強大的工具,可以幫助你更有效地管理和組織 CSS 代碼。選擇哪種取決于你的團隊和項目的需求,以及你個人的偏好。如果你剛剛開始使用預處理器,SCSS 可能是一個更好的選擇,因為它更容易上手。如果你喜歡更簡潔的語法并且不介意適應一種新的代碼風格,那么你可以嘗試 Sass。無論哪種語法,它們都提供了變量、嵌套、混合(mixins)等功能,可以大大改善 CSS 的可維護性和可重用性。文章來源地址http://www.zghlxwxcb.cn/news/detail-706822.html

到了這里,關于sass和scss 有何區(qū)別?的文章就介紹完了。如果您還想了解更多內容,請在右上角搜索TOY模板網以前的文章或繼續(xù)瀏覽下面的相關文章,希望大家以后多多支持TOY模板網!

本文來自互聯(lián)網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。如若轉載,請注明出處: 如若內容造成侵權/違法違規(guī)/事實不符,請點擊違法舉報進行投訴反饋,一經查實,立即刪除!

領支付寶紅包贊助服務器費用

相關文章

  • 前端-Sass和Less區(qū)別

    Less和Sass都是CSS預處理器,它們提供了更強大、更靈活的方式來編寫CSS樣式。以下是Less和Sass之間的一些區(qū)別 : 語法:Less使用類似于CSS的語法,而Sass使用類似于Ruby的語法。Less使用大括號 {} 和分號 ; 來表示代碼塊和語句,而Sass使用縮進和冒號 : 來表示。 文件擴展名:Less文

    2024年02月12日
    瀏覽(26)
  • Sass 和 SCSS

    Sass 和 SCSS

    ?Sass (Syntactically Awesome StyleSheets),是由 buby語言 編寫的一款 css預處理語言 ,和html一樣有 嚴格的縮進風格 ,和css編寫規(guī)范有著很大的出入,是不使用花括號和分號的,所以不被廣為接受。 Sass 是一款強化 CSS 的輔助工具,是對 CSS 的擴展 ,它在 CSS 語法的基礎上增加了 變量

    2023年04月08日
    瀏覽(16)
  • Frontend - SASS / SCSS 文件使用

    目錄 一、安裝所需依賴 1. django-compressor? 2. django-sass-processor 二、settings.py 文件配置 三、html使用 1. 配置 2. 導入 1. django-compressor? 2. django-sass-processor 安裝依賴,可參考另一篇文章:Backend - 安裝依賴(pip 、tar.gz)_python通過tar.gz包安裝依賴包-CSDN博客 1. 配置 2. 導入

    2024年01月24日
    瀏覽(16)
  • vue中引入sass、scss

    vue中引入sass、scss

    使用vue cli 腳手架工具創(chuàng)建項目 全局樣式變量 路徑:@/assets/styles/variables.scss 布局樣式類 路徑:@/assets/styles/layout.scss 全局共用樣式 路徑:@/assets/styles/main.scss 在App.vue或者main.js中映入均可 在vue.config.js中配置全局樣式類,具體配置方法可以參考vue cli官方文檔 原因 產生的原因

    2024年01月17日
    瀏覽(18)
  • Vue項目自動注入less、sass、scss、stylus全局變量

    一、Vue2項目 官方文檔:CSS 相關 | Vue CLI 二、Vue3項目 2024-4-9

    2024年04月15日
    瀏覽(20)
  • uni-app 之 安裝uView,安裝scss/sass編譯

    uni-app 之 安裝uView,安裝scss/sass編譯

    uni-app 之 安裝uView,安裝scss/sass編譯 image.png image.png image.png 點擊HBuilder X 頂部,工具,插件安裝,安裝新插件 image.png image.png 安裝成功! 注意,一定要先登錄才可以安裝 image.png 1. 引入uView主JS庫 在項目根目錄中的 main.js 中,引入并使用uView的JS庫,注意這兩行要放在 import Vu

    2024年02月10日
    瀏覽(35)
  • SCSS 學習筆記 和 vscode下載live sass compiler插件配置

    SCSS 學習筆記 和 vscode下載live sass compiler插件配置

    SCSS 是一個 CSS 的預處理器,是 CSS 的擴展語言,可以幫助我們減少重復的代碼,生成更好的 CSS 格式化代碼,并且兼容所有版本的 CSS SCSS 是 對于 CSS3 的 SASS ,所以我們學的時候,把文件后綴寫為 “.scss” 由于我們的配置,當遇到兼容性代碼,出口文件會自動配置,如下圖

    2024年02月12日
    瀏覽(22)
  • 一文分清:Less、Sass、Scss、stylus,看看與css的對比

    一文分清:Less、Sass、Scss、stylus,看看與css的對比

    CSS 預處理器是一種將預先定義的語法和功能添加到 CSS 中的工具。它們允許開發(fā)人員使用變量、嵌套規(guī)則、混合、繼承等功能,以更高效和可維護的方式編寫樣式表。 ? CSS 預處理器的作用包括: 變量和計算 :預處理器允許開發(fā)人員使用變量來存儲顏色、字體、尺寸等值,以

    2024年01月25日
    瀏覽(23)
  • 云計算與 SaaS 有何區(qū)別?

    云計算與 SaaS 有何區(qū)別?

    云計算與 SaaS 有何區(qū)別?眾所周知,SaaS是云計算的三種服務模式其中之一。 三種分別是: Iaas:基礎設施即服務 Paas:平臺即服務 SaaS:軟件即服務 對于三者的區(qū)別,一起來吃頓烤肉,聽我慢慢說: 吃烤肉需要準備好五花肉、蔬菜、調味醬等等食材,還要準備好煤氣、烤爐等

    2024年02月11日
    瀏覽(20)
  • 不同類型的工業(yè)網關有何區(qū)別?

    工業(yè)網關是一種用于連接工業(yè)設備和網絡的關鍵設備,它能夠將不同協(xié)議、不同傳輸速率的工業(yè)設備連接到網絡上,實現(xiàn)數(shù)據(jù)的傳輸和共享。不同類型的工業(yè)網關之間存在一些區(qū)別,以下是一些常見的工業(yè)網關類型及其區(qū)別: 協(xié)議轉換型工業(yè)網關:這種網關主要用于實現(xiàn)不同

    2024年03月09日
    瀏覽(20)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請作者喝杯咖啡吧~博客贊助

支付寶掃一掃領取紅包,優(yōu)惠每天領

二維碼1

領取紅包

二維碼2

領紅包